Default Mini tach help needed, instructions lost

I'm helping my dad yank some parts off his 2006 1200C before trading it in (Night Rod Special). He had them install a mini-tach when he bought the bike (different dealer) but he doesn't have the instructions. I added a mini tach to my Dyna but it was wired the old fashioned way with splices and his looks like it *might* be a simple plug-in installation.

It appears that the wire bundle for the tach goes down and around the left side of the bike and plugs into a connector just behind the left downtube. The wire bundle also splits and goes under the tank. Is this wire bundle only for the tach? Is there a simple plug under the tank such that this whole wiring harness is easily removed?

Or, is this a spliced installation and the guys just did a great job of making it look like factory wiring?

Or, is the bike prewired and this harness isn't part of the tach kit, but rather I just need to tuck the wires out of site after removal.

We won't have much time tomorrow to pull parts and I don't want to waste time getting under that tank to find out where that bundle leads. If it is spliced, we'll probably just leave it. The goal is just to make sure I remove what came with the tach so we can sell it and the buyer will have everything they need. So if anyone can shed some light on this, I'd greatly appreciate it.
